Black beans are vegan, unless they are cooked in animal fat or broth. In some regions of Latin America, refried black beans are typically prepared with lard (animal fat). Chipotle offers two types of beans: black beans and pinto beans. The black beans are seasoned with spices for a slightly smoky flavor, while the pinto beans are cooked with a blend of herbs and spices, including garlic and onion. Customers can choose either or both types of beans to customize their burritos, bowls, and other menu items.
